Continua: the $100 Moog One


Published on Jan 11, 2020 NONsynth

"I've been obsessed with this Moog video with Paris Strother [posted here]: which features my favourite synth line / chord progression ever. I thought my love for this sound meant I needed to get a Moog One to be happy.

I wanted to see if I could recreate it using the new Audio Damage Continua plugin. In so doing, realized two things:

[1] Continua is my new favourite synth plugin. The oscillator Warp and Skew parameters are so good on a sine wave, introducing all sorts of additional harmonics. I'll be using these settings until I can't stand to hear them anymore.

[2] The sound from the original is amazing, but it's really the chord progression and playing that make it shine. I bet this Continua patch would come alive if Paris was playing instead of it being a midi sequence."
